From the City of Pineville:
The City of Pineville will again be distributing bottled water, and ice (as available) on Friday morning, beginning at 10:00, on the parking lot of Furniture World. This process will continue as long as supplies last.
A SPECIAL thank you to Plasti-Pak Packaging for another truck load of bottled water, to Sen. Joe McPherson for two trucks of ice, and the Louisiana National Guard for more supplies to meet the needs of residents of North Rapides.
We must also thank Furniture Word on Highway 28 East, who suffered damage to their roof from Gustav and has let us use their parking lot for this distribution center.
Our water well status is improving, while we are still working on power to our lift stations to improve sewer service. We hope to have an update on the boil advisory soon.
NOTE: Rich DuPree reports all 10 City wells are now working.
